Output 253b2b5c729169d4cc6becb989dee3a87d36adaae937aa77d3d8affd33367b81:5

value
1086487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8296ec3ec40e944c33aac4c363c2154a95d71cf0 OP_EQUAL
address
3DbWZnRWPUnfUwU8eAbEjm9oHVxdFCrNRT
transaction
253b2b5c729169d4cc6becb989dee3a87d36adaae937aa77d3d8affd33367b81
spent
true